About the Scholarship

Supports graduate students pursuing a doctoral degree in dentistry

Anna Frutiger will always be remembered for her dedication to her friends and family, her education and her love for serving her community. She graduated from Alma High School in 2005 as a valedictorian of her class and went on to receive her Bachelor of Science degree in molecular biology at Kenyon College in Gambier, Ohio in 2009. Anna had just completed her first year of dental school at University of Pittsburgh when she suffered a fatal pulmonary embolism May of 2010.

Anna’s family established this scholarship in her memory to recognize a student who has the same passion for serving others and exemplifies the dedication to pursing a profession in dentistry.

Number of Awards and Value

One for as much as $3,000.

Requirements

  • Must be a graduate student pursuing a doctoral degree in dentistry at an accredited US dental school;
  • Must be a graduate of a Gratiot County high school with preference to Alma High School graduates;
  • Must demonstrate financial need, academic excellence and high moral character;
  • Must provide evidence of service to community;
  • Must submit essay on goals as a dental professional;
  • Must provide personal letter of reference from academic advisor, clergy member or other nonfamily member attesting to community service and high moral character.
